Kibo Energy Plc is listed in the Gold Ores s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ker KIBO. The last closing price for Kibo Energy was 0.01p. Over the last year, Kibo Energy shares have traded in a share price range of 0.01p to 0.0675p.

Kibo Energy currently has 4,360,947,764 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Kibo Energy is £436,095 . Kibo Energy has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-0.05.
